    • A method and apparatus for determining and displaying icons representing files containing text, such as e-mail, web pages, text documents, word-processor documents, etc. In particular, the system determines the content of the text by examining words in the document. For example, if words relating to cars appear several times in the document, then the document's topic probably relates to car. Next, the system searches in a database of icons, which are labeled according to type. For example, the database may contain graphics relating to transportation (cars, planes, trains, etc.) computers (hard disk, monitor, keyboard, etc.), animals (mammal, reptile, amphibian), and many other categories. The system chooses the closest icon available and displays it as the icon representing the text document. (For example, the system may associate the document on cars with a car icon, and the car icon is displayed in appropriate regions of the desktop such as in file listings, desktop shortcuts, menus task bars, etc.).

    • A system and method for automatic ways of prioritizing the presentation of windows on a graphical user interface (GUI) and for prioritizing and accessing information stored in cache that is used by a web browser. The viewing (tiling) priority of windows, the size of windows, and the position of windows on a GUI are automatically determined from the following criteria: the time the window was first opened, the time the window was last opened, the length of time the window was visible on the screen, the percentage visibility of the window, the amount of scrolling the window has undergone, the content of the window, the time of day, the number of window accesses, and/or some mathematical function of these criteria. Additionally, these same criteria are applied to cached information associated with web pages so that more “relevant” cached web pages are automatically stored in cache for longer periods of time before being discarded in a finite sized cache. The cached information is more quickly accessible by hitting a “back-like” button that shows more relevant (i.e. higher priority) information before less relevant information.

    • Information presentation system comprises a computer device having a display terminal for providing a graphical user interface (GUI), capable of generating a cluster of items comprising graphical or textual elements for display thereof according to a fractal appearance. Each item in a cluster represents information having a degree of relatedness with information represented by other items in a cluster. A control mechanism is provided for controlling the spatial extent, nesting and arrangement of items within a cluster according to a specified criteria, which spatial extent and arrangement is controlled to provide optimal display and conserve screen display space on the display terminal. Users may manually enter a criteria for organizing and adjusting the spatial extent of a cluster in order to provide continuous display space on the computer display terminal. The invention may be implemented in text editors to provide a multiresolution annotation feature for portable and lap/palm-top computer devices having pen-based or keyboard based inputs.
